docker怎么部署多个web应用

435
2023/10/14 9:43:45
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

可以通过以下几种方式来部署多个web应用:

  1. 使用多个Docker容器:可以为每个web应用创建一个独立的Docker容器,并使用不同的端口映射来访问它们。每个容器可以包含一个完整的web应用的运行环境,并独立运行。

  2. 使用Docker Compose: Docker Compose是一个用于定义和管理多个Docker容器应用的工具。可以使用一个docker-compose.yml文件来定义多个web应用的容器,并定义它们之间的关系和依赖。然后使用docker-compose命令来启动和管理这些容器。

  3. 使用Docker Swarm: Docker Swarm是Docker的原生集群管理工具,可以将多个Docker主机组合成一个单一的虚拟Docker主机。可以在Swarm集群中部署多个web应用,并使用Swarm的服务发现和负载均衡功能来访问它们。

  4. 使用Kubernetes: Kubernetes是一个容器编排平台,可以用于部署和管理多个容器化的应用。可以使用Kubernetes来部署和管理多个web应用,并使用其自动伸缩和负载均衡功能来处理流量。

以上这些方法都可以用来部署和管理多个web应用,具体选择哪种方法取决于你的需求和技术栈。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: docker如何搭建redis集群